Discover the Serenity of Núi Ngoạ Long (Lying Dragon Mountain)

Núi Ngoạ Long, also known as Lying Dragon Mountain, is a stunning landmark located in the heart of Ninh Bình, Vietnam. This magnificent mountain is characterized by its unique shape resembling a dragon lying down, which has captivated the hearts of many tourists and locals alike. The site is surrounded by lush greenery and offers a breathtaking view of the picturesque landscapes that define this region. As you navigate the trails of Núi Ngoạ Long, you will find yourself surrounded by towering limestone karsts and serene rice paddies that stretch as far as the eye can see. The mountain is not only a feast for the eyes but also carries significant cultural importance. It is home to various ancient temples and shrines, which add a spiritual dimension to your visit. As you explore, take the time to appreciate the intricate architecture of these religious sites, which are deeply rooted in Vietnamese history and traditions. Whether you are an avid hiker or a leisurely traveler, Núi Ngoạ Long offers a plethora of activities that cater to all types of visitors, from trekking to photography. Moreover, the area is rich in biodiversity, making it a perfect spot for nature lovers and bird watchers. The tranquility of Núi Ngoạ Long is truly unmatched, inviting visitors to take a moment to reflect and soak in the beauty around them. Local tips

  • Visit early in the morning to enjoy cooler temperatures and fewer crowds.
  • Wear comfortable hiking shoes, as the trails can be steep and uneven.
  • Bring a camera to capture the stunning landscapes and unique rock formations.
  • Try to visit during the dry season (November to April) for the best weather conditions.
  • Don't miss the chance to explore nearby attractions, such as Tam Coc and Bich Dong Pagoda.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from Hanoi, take National Route 1A south towards Ninh Binh. The journey is approximately 90 km and takes about 2 hours. Once you arrive in Ninh Binh, follow the signs to Hoa Lu, which is around 12 km from Ninh Binh city center. Continue on the road until you reach the coordinates (20.2294138, 105.933657). There is an entrance fee of 100,000 VND to access the area around Núi Ngoạ Long.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Núi Ngoạ Long using public transportation, take a bus from Hanoi to Ninh Binh. Buses depart frequently from My Dinh Bus Station. The journey takes about 2-3 hours and costs around 100,000 to 150,000 VND. Once in Ninh Binh, you can take a local taxi or ride-hailing service to Hoa Lu. The distance is about 12 km and should cost around 200,000 to 300,000 VND. Upon arrival, head to the coordinates (20.2294138, 105.933657), where you will need to pay an entrance fee of 100,000 VND.

  • Taxi or Ride-Hailing Service

    If you are already in Ninh Binh city, you can take a taxi or use a ride-hailing app like Grab to reach Núi Ngoạ Long. Make sure to input the destination coordinates (20.2294138, 105.933657). The ride should take about 20 minutes and cost between 200,000 to 300,000 VND, depending on traffic conditions. Remember, there is an entrance fee of 100,000 VND to access the area.
